STF Justice Alexandre de Moraes and the Limits of Expression

Supreme Tribunal Justice Alexandre de Moraes has come under intense scrutiny for his rulings on freedom of expression in Brazil. Critics argue that his decisions constitute an alarming trend toward censorship and the suppression of dissent, while supporters maintain that he is upholding the law and protecting Brazilian democracy from harmful online content. Moraes's jurisprudence often focuses on combating misinformation and hate speech, which he pose a significant threat to social harmony and political stability. His actions have sparked heated debate about the delicate balance between protecting fundamental rights and safeguarding national security in the digital age.

One of Moraes's most controversial decisions was to order the suspension of several social media accounts perceived as spreading false information about the 2022 election. This move drew criticism from human rights groups who argued that it violated freedom of speech. Moraes, however, defended his actions, stating that he was performing his duties to protect the integrity of the electoral process.

The debate surrounding Moraes's decisions is unlikely to be resolved soon. As technology evolves and the lines between permissible and harmful online content become increasingly blurred, courts like Brazil's Supreme Tribunal will continue to struggle complex questions about the limits of expression in a digital society.
